c语言ascii码表空格,c语言 ascii码
作者:admin日期:2024-02-20 03:30:17浏览:40分类:资讯
ASCII字符表中的空白是什么
ASCII码表中的空白字符主要有:空格(0x20,),回车符(0x0D,‘\r’),换行符(0x0A,\n),水平制表符(0x09,\t),垂直制表符(0x0B,\v),换页符(\f)。
在C语言中,空格字符可以使用转义字符序列表示,即使用反斜杠(\)和空格字符的ASCII码的缩写组合。空格字符的ASCII码为32,其缩写为s。
ASCII值10和13分别转换为退格符、制表符、换行符和回车符。它们没有特定的图形显示,但是根据应用程序的不同,它们对文本显示有不同的效果。
C语言中不能打印的字符都是空白字符,在ASCII标准表中一共有32个。加上空格字符,制表字符一共有34个。
空白符 通常指 空格符,回车符\r,换行符 \n,制表符 \t它们的ASCII 码值 不同,分别为 十进制 32 13 10 9。作为控制键 使用 时,控制作用 不同。空格符 打字机打印头横走一格。
ASCII码是一种常用的字符编码标准。在ASCII码中,空格的ASCII码值为32。在计算机中,字符和数字等数据都是以二进制形式表示的,而不是以人类可读的字符形式。
c语言中表示空格的是什么代码?
1、分析如下:不是所有字符都需要转义的,空格直接就敲空格,或者使用ASCII码值赋值为32。空格没有转义字符。
2、在C语言中,空格字符可以使用转义字符序列表示,即使用反斜杠(\)和空格字符的ASCII码的缩写组合。空格字符的ASCII码为32,其缩写为s。
3、定义主函数void main(){},在主函数中插入如下代码:char blank[2]={ }; printf(%s\n,blank);按红叹号测试。
4、在test.cpp文件中,输入C语言代码:char a = ;printf(%c1, a);。编译器运行test.cpp文件,此时成功表示了空格并打印了出来。
空格字符的ASCLL代码是多少
ASCII码表中的空白字符主要有:空格(0x20,),回车符(0x0D,‘\r’),换行符(0x0A,\n),水平制表符(0x09,\t),垂直制表符(0x0B,\v),换页符(\f)。
空格的ASCII码值为32;数字0到9的ASCII码值分别为48到57;大写字母“A”到“Z”的ASCII码值分别为65到90;小写字母“a”到“z”的ASCII码值分别为97到到122。
\)和空格字符的ASCII码的缩写组合。空格字符的ASCII码为32,其缩写为s。因此,在C语言中,空格可以表示为:或者使用转义字符表示:这里的\x表示使用十六进制ASCII码表示字符,20是空格字符的十六进制ASCII码。
空格的ASCII码值为32。ASCII码是一种常用的字符编码标准。在ASCII码中,空格的ASCII码值为32。在计算机中,字符和数字等数据都是以二进制形式表示的,而不是以人类可读的字符形式。
字符空格的ASCII值为32;不为0;C不为空,故!C为假,b的值为0;想不到楼上那样的老手都会出错。
C语言里如何判断空格
1、写好开头#includestdio.h,void main()。输入一对大括号{},之后所有的步骤都在其中进行 ,定义整形变量n1,n2,n3,n4和字符变量c。通过循环控制字符串输入并判断(while循环时需加一组大括号)。
2、空格 用 ASCII 值 0x20 判断。
3、可以通过判断输出字符当中是否有空格字符来确定是否有空格符号。空格符是存在的字符,ASCII是32。例如:char s[10000];//字符数组缓存sprintf(s,%d%c%f,...); //先把输出的内容先打印到字符数组缓存当中。
4、c的值就是空格的ASCII码值,此时while循环终止,不再从键盘取得字符赋给c。相当于:从键盘输入一个字符 :getchar()然后把字符的值赋给c :c=getchar()然后判断c是否等于‘ ’ , 代表空格。
5、上述问题的解决方法之一就是可以在读取字符之前,先确保前面没有换行符。上面的方法只是针对换行符,但是如果是其他空白字符的话,就有些麻烦了。在C标准库中有一个函数可以用来检测空白字符,我们需要包含头文件 ctype.h 。
C语言编程输出ASCII码表中的可见部分
首先定义一个变量a作为需要输出ASCII码的变量,这里演示以字符变量a为例。接着使用scanf()函数接受从键盘输入的字符。然后使用printf()语句将字符a用整数的格式输出。
++count[index];//更新字母对应的计数器 } //循环输出每个字母对应的计数 for(size_t i=0;i26;++i){ printf(%c : %d\n,a+i, count[i]);} return 0;} //手机写的,未加验证。
C 语言中,字符变量的类型是 char,它表示一个单个字符。在输出字符变量的值和字符形式时,我们使用了 %c 格式化字符串,表示输出一个字符。在输出字符变量的ASCII码时,我们使用了 %d 格式化字符串,表示输出一个整数。
在C语言中输出时:空格符与空字符有什么区别?
真空 的区别;虽然都看不见,但是空气是存在的,真空却是什么都没有。空格符是存在的字符,只不过是打印了,看不见而已,ASCII是32。
有区别。输出空格在屏幕上显示的是空格。但是输出空字符就没有显示。因为空字符是作为一个字符串的结束标志。你可以编个简单的程序试一下。
空格字符是编码为32的一个字符,用表示(注意两个单引号之间有空位),显示出来是一个空白。比如“a b”,在a和b之间就是一个空格字符。
空格字符 指键盘上长长的那个键产生的字符,16进制0x20, 十进制32。而空字符是在字符串结尾系统自动加上的‘\0’,以让系统识别出一个字符串的结尾。
猜你还喜欢
- 05-15 房屋设计语言,房屋设计理念文案
- 04-20 计算机语言排行榜,计算机语言排行榜前十
- 04-18 strlen函数c语言,c语言strlen的用法
- 04-17 c语言定义数组的三种方式,c语言中怎样定义一个数组
- 04-15 c语言程序设计何钦铭电子书,c语言程序设计何钦铭第二版pdf
- 04-15 软件开发语言排行,软件开发语言有哪些
- 04-13 a的ascii码怎么算,a的ascii码值是多少二进制
- 04-10 c语言数组平移,c语言如何把数组往后移
- 04-08 c语言程序设计谭浩强pdf,C语言程序设计谭浩强pdf
- 04-08 go语言高级编程,go语言高级编程 电子书
- 04-08 易语言下载进度条,易语言进度条加载程序
- 04-07 易语言论坛社区,易语言官方下载
取消回复欢迎 你 发表评论:
- 最近发表
- 标签列表
- 友情链接
暂无评论,来添加一个吧。